The core of the AD-Tech lies in its RO+UV+UF 10-stage purification cycle. By combining these three technologies, the system targets dissolved solids, pathogens, and fine suspended particles in sequence. The 0.25 L/min flow rate ensures that the 12 L tank refills steadily without straining the internal pump. Operating mechanics are centered around its ability to handle a maximum TDS threshold of 2000 ppm. This makes it a robust choice for regions where groundwater contains high levels of dissolved minerals. The build quality utilizes food-grade materials to prevent secondary contamination within the storage reservoir. Noise levels during the RO pump operation are kept within standard residential limits to avoid domestic disturbance. The 60 W power rating is optimized for Indian electrical grids, ensuring stable performance during voltage fluctuations.
